Smart Water for a Residential Complex

Variable-frequency + PLC pressure control and remote cistern monitoring with automatic alerts for a residential complex.

The challenge

Water pumps with abrupt starts and high consumption, plus a makeshift cistern-level check (a rope to measure). The complex ran out of water during unexpected supply cuts.

02

The solution

We deployed a variable-frequency drive governed by a PLC that adjusts pressure in real time to demand, avoiding abrupt starts and saving energy. An HMI panel operates main and backup pumps, shows pressure and schedules cycles. A pressure transducer, combined with level calculations, feeds an Internet monitoring system (Savix) that notifies management and the water-truck supplier —with automatic invoicing— when the cistern drops below threshold.

03

The result

Continuous supply, lower pump energy use and an end to empty-cistern outages: better quality of life for residents.
